The previous US president mentioned he’s executed nothing fallacious, however added that fees wouldn’t cease him from working for workplace once more
Former US President Donald Trump mentioned that prison fees wouldn’t forestall him from working for workplace in 2024, however would trigger “massive issues” within the nation. Beset by a number of investigations, which he argues are politically motivated, Trump insisted that he broke no legal guidelines.
“I can’t think about being indicted. I’ve executed nothing fallacious,” Trump instructed radio host Hugh Hewitt on Thursday. Nonetheless, ought to he be slapped with prison fees, he doesn’t “suppose the folks of america would stand for it.”
“I believe if it occurred, I believe you’d have issues on this nation the likes of which maybe, we have by no means seen earlier than…massive issues,” he added.
Trump is presently dealing with three grand jury investigations. One District of Columbia probe is analyzing his alleged mishandling of categorised paperwork in his Mar-a-Lago property in Florida, whereas one other federal investigation is trying into his position within the riot on Capitol Hill on January 6, 2021. In the meantime, a state probe in Georgia is investigating whether or not the previous president broke the legislation by pressuring state officers to overturn Joe Biden’s electoral victory within the state in 2020.
The January 6 investigation has seen federal brokers seize communications data of Trump’s allies, whereas the DC probe noticed FBI brokers stage a raid on Mar-a-Lago looking for secret paperwork. Trump maintains that he declassified any paperwork on his property, and that the raid was a “third world” instance of “political persecution.”
Ought to Trump really be indicted, he mentioned that he “would don’t have any prohibition towards working” for workplace once more. Whereas Trump has not formally introduced one other bid for the presidency in 2024, he’s broadly believed to be making ready to run, and leads most polls of Republican candidates.
“There is no such thing as a purpose that they will [indict me],” Trump instructed Hewitt, “aside from in the event that they’re simply sick and deranged, which is at all times doable.”
